Butterfly Away, watercolor by Deanna St Martin
Art du Jour is pleased to announce our new member Deanna St. Martin who will be the featured artist in the main gallery for the month of March. Her vibrant, spontaneous paintings start out simply as she uses Halloween cobwebs to create the texture for the under paintings. She then sprays on liquid watercolors and manipulates the paint, moving it, brushing it and continuing to amend the painting. She uses watercolors, ephemeral, watercolor pencils, acrylics, watercolor paper and Yopo. St. Martin says, “The slickness of the Yupo combined with the viscosity of the paint interact perfectly to create chaos and out of chaos comes harmony of design.” Her inspiration comes from nature and things that she sees every day.
